create function gen_unique_name(
separator text = '_',
variadic word_kinds word_kind[] = '{"color", "adjective", "animal"}')
returns text as $$
declare
v_word_kind word_kind;
v_words text[] := '{}';
v_word text;
begin
foreach v_word_kind in array word_kinds loop
v_word := '';
if v_word_kind = 'animal' then
select word into v_word from animal_words order by random() limit 1;
elsif v_word_kind = 'color' then
select word into v_word from color_words order by random() limit 1;
elsif v_word_kind = 'adjective' then
select word into v_word from adjective_words order by random() limit 1;
end if;
v_words := v_words || v_word;
end loop;
return concat_ws(separator, variadic v_words);
end
$$ language plpgsql stable;
